Our RESTful API for Chevrolet is fast, reliable, and easy to use with every tech stack. No matter which framework your mobile or web app is built in, our documentation and SDKs support every major language.
const smartcar = require('smartcar');
// Get all vehicles associated with this access token
const {vehicles} = await smartcar.getVehicles("<access-token>");
// Construct a new vehicle instance using the first vehicle's id
const vehicle = new smartcar.Vehicle(vehicles[0], "<access-token>");
// Fetch the vehicle's location
const location = await vehicle.location();
// Example http response from Smartcar
{
"latitude": 37.4292,
"longitude": 122.1381
}
